Reagents

Reagents Reagents the backbone of many types of labs and are used for various tests and experiments in almost every industry. They are substances or compounds that are added in order to either cause or gauge if a chemical reaction occurs. Common reagents include -but are certainly not limited to- sodium hydroxide, lysosome, citric acid, chloroform, and ethanol. Important considerations for choosing a reagent include the desired reaction, concentration, and grade.
